Max and Daddy had a blast at Fathers and Sons Campout




Max missed the Fathers and Sons camp out last year because he was sick, so this year he was extremely excited to attend. The Fathers and Sons camp out is a tradition in our church where the dads and all boys aged from as young as you want, up to 18 all go camping together one time each year.
